Brunswick Station is well-equipped to handle travelers with diverse needs. The station operates with a ticket office open from as early as 5:53 AM to midnight on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 8:04 AM until midnight on Sundays, ensuring passengers have ample opportunities for assistance. While ticket machines are unavailable, tickets purchased online can be collected from the office. The station supports smartcards, providing a tech-savvy alternative for frequent travelers.
Accessibility is a prime focus at Brunswick. The station boasts step-free access across all platforms, making it easy for passengers with mobility issues to navigate their way around. However, note that there are no accessible ticket machines. Amenities like seating areas for waiting are available, although the station lacks extensive retail and refreshment facilities—apart from a food vending machine—and there are no ATMs on-site.
Brunswick's location is a gateway to various transport options. Although there isn't a taxi rank directly at the station, you're well connected with local bus services. Check out Merseytravel for bus connections, or reach out via Traveline at 0871 200 2233 for up-to-date information. A noteworthy mention is its proximity to Liverpool John Lennon Airport. You can simply purchase a rail/bus ticket combo to make your travel seamless.

While modest in size, Theobalds Grove station is equipped with essential amenities designed to help you navigate your journey with ease. Although it lacks an on-site ticket office, automated ticket machines are provided for you to purchase or collect pre-booked tickets effortlessly. The station supports accessible ticketing facilities, offering an induction loop for those with hearing impairments.
For individuals requiring assistance, the station staff is available from the early hours of the morning to late at night. Passenger information can be accessed through departure and arrival screens and regular announcements, ensuring that you stay informed about your train's status or any service updates.
Theobalds Grove prioritizes accessibility, albeit offering limited step-free access. The station lacks fully accessible platforms, but it does feature three parking spaces specifically for accessible vehicles. There’s no waiting room or toilets, yet passengers can find refuge in the available seating areas. Additionally, vending machines offer refreshments to keep travelers refreshed during their journey.
Well-connected to various transport modes, Theobalds Grove station simplifies onward travel with local bus services stopping directly at the station. Both northbound services towards Cheshunt and southbound routes to Seven Sisters or Liverpool Street are easily accessible from nearby bus stops. These robust connections facilitate effortless transit within and beyond the local and Greater London area.
